Injection Water Quality Requirements
The water quality required for an oil reservoir is primarily a function of reservoir permeability. Tight, low-permeability zones generally require better-quality water than higher-permeability zones.
When the injection water quality is inadequate, the consequence can be inferior a reservoir plugging. The result of plugging is reduced sweep efficiency, which results in decreased recovery and, ultimately, loss of revenue. Also, operational costs are increased because of workovers and system repairs required to restore injectivity.
Generally, the following analyses and calculations are required to determine Injection water quality:
Injection water physical and chemical characteristics;
Sulphate reducing bacteria (SRB) count;
The suspended solids content and particle size distribution;
Scaling tendencies;
Injection and formation water compatibility (total produced formation water and produced formation water from different oil wells);
